news 2026/4/18 8:05:32

传统vs现代:DDoS防护效率对比分析

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
传统vs现代:DDoS防护效率对比分析

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
    开发一个DDoS防护效率对比工具,能够模拟传统规则匹配和现代AI算法两种防护方式,实时展示两者的检测准确率、响应时间和系统资源占用情况。工具应提供可视化对比图表,帮助用户直观理解不同方案的优劣。
  3. 点击'项目生成'按钮,等待项目生成完整后预览效果

最近在调研网络安全防护方案时,发现DDoS攻击的防御手段已经从传统的规则匹配逐渐转向AI驱动的智能防护。为了更直观地理解两者的差异,我尝试开发了一个DDoS防护效率对比工具,可以实时展示两种方案的性能表现。

  1. 工具设计思路
    这个工具的核心是模拟两种防护机制:传统方案基于预设规则(如IP黑名单、流量阈值),现代方案则使用机器学习模型动态分析流量特征。通过并行处理相同攻击样本,对比它们的响应速度、误判率和CPU/内存消耗。

  2. 关键指标实现

  3. 响应时间:从攻击流量进入系统到触发防御动作的延迟,现代方案通过特征提取模型可缩短至毫秒级
  4. 误报率:传统规则容易因固定阈值误判正常流量,AI模型通过行为分析降低误杀
  5. 资源占用:规则匹配消耗较少但扩展性差,AI需要初期训练成本但能自适应新攻击

  6. 可视化呈现
    工具使用动态折线图展示实时流量处理情况,柱状图对比历史数据中的误报次数,并监控系统资源面板显示内存/CPU使用率变化。这种设计让技术差异变得一目了然。

  7. 实际测试发现
    在模拟10000次请求的测试中,传统方案平均响应时间为120ms,AI方案仅35ms;面对新型变种攻击时,规则匹配的误报率高达15%,而AI模型保持在3%以下。不过AI方案初期需要约20%的额外CPU资源用于模型推理。

  8. 优化方向
    现代方案可通过模型量化技术降低资源消耗,传统方法则可结合轻量级AI作为补充检测层。未来考虑加入混合模式对比测试。

在InsCode(快马)平台部署这个工具特别方便,它的内置环境直接支持Python机器学习库和可视化组件,不需要自己配置Web服务器。点击部署按钮后,系统自动生成可公开访问的演示页面,还能随时调整参数重新测试。

实际操作中发现,平台预装的Jupyter Notebook模板能快速启动分析程序,实时预览功能让调试效率提升不少。对于需要持续运行的服务类项目,这种一键发布的方式确实省去了很多运维麻烦。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
    开发一个DDoS防护效率对比工具,能够模拟传统规则匹配和现代AI算法两种防护方式,实时展示两者的检测准确率、响应时间和系统资源占用情况。工具应提供可视化对比图表,帮助用户直观理解不同方案的优劣。
  3. 点击'项目生成'按钮,等待项目生成完整后预览效果

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 7:52:57

27、Linux文件与目录管理技术详解

Linux文件与目录管理技术详解 1. 特殊设备介绍 在Linux系统中,存在一些特殊的设备,它们在文件和目录管理中有着独特的用途。 - 零设备(Zero Device) :零设备位于 /dev/zero ,主设备号为1,次设备号为5。与空设备类似,内核会默默地丢弃对零设备的写入操作。当从该…

作者头像 李华
网站建设 2026/4/16 21:44:16

15分钟搭建SM2加密API服务

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 构建一个RESTful API服务:1. /generate-key 生成密钥对 2. /encrypt 接收明文返回密文 3. /decrypt 接收密文返回明文 4. 添加Swagger文档。使用FastAPI框架&#xff0c…

作者头像 李华
网站建设 2026/4/18 7:58:08

jquery的基本使用(3)

jquery操作元素内容添加元素append,prepend,before,after:$(function(){var dom $("#container_id");dom.append("<span>我是append添加的元素</span>");dom.prepend("<span>我是prepend添加的元素</span>");dom.after…

作者头像 李华
网站建设 2026/4/13 8:05:03

低钠咸鸭蛋:三高人群也能吃的改良配方

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容&#xff1a; 开发健康版咸鸭蛋配方定制工具&#xff1a;1) 需求选择&#xff08;低钠/低胆固醇/高钙&#xff09;2) 替代方案推荐&#xff08;海盐/竹盐/香料增味&#xff09;3) 动态营养计算器…

作者头像 李华
网站建设 2026/4/18 8:01:07

AI如何帮你快速掌握Java响应式编程Flux

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容&#xff1a; 创建一个Java项目&#xff0c;使用Spring WebFlux框架实现一个简单的响应式API。要求包含以下功能&#xff1a;1. 使用Flux模拟实时数据流&#xff0c;每秒发射一个递增数字&#x…

作者头像 李华
网站建设 2026/4/17 17:53:48

数据仓库的应用

定义数据仓库&#xff08;Data Warehouse, DW&#xff09;是一个面向主题的、集成的、相对稳定的、反映历史变化的数据集合&#xff0c;用于支持管理决策。它不同于传统的操作型数据库&#xff08;如交易系统数据库&#xff09;&#xff0c;后者主要用于日常业务处理。数据仓库…

作者头像 李华